When you're looking at a new fireplace, the bottom line depends on a few specific things. First, are we working with an existing chimney or venting system, or does everything need to be built from scratch? The type of fuel matters too—gas, electric, or wood-burning units all carry different installation requirements. You also have to consider the finish work, like custom stonework, mantels, or drywall repairs around the unit. Labor complexity is the biggest factor here. The price to install an electric fireplace is determined by the complexity of the mount and any electrical work needed. Recessed units that require framing and drywall repair typically cost more than simple wall-hung models. You may also see price changes if you choose a custom mantel or stone finish to complete the look. We assess your specific layout to give you a clear estimate. Gas logs are decorative pieces that mimic the look of burning wood in a gas fireplace. They provide ambiance without the mess of real wood. Choosing the right size and style can greatly enhance the appearance of your fireplace in Louisville/Jefferson County.
